usb: gadget: tegra-xudc: Add handling for BLCG_COREPLL_PWRDN

The COREPLL_PWRDN bit in the BLCG register must be set when the XUSB
device controller is powergated and cleared when it is unpowergated.
If this bit is not explicitly controlled, the core PLL may remain in an
incorrect power state across suspend/resume or ELPG transitions.
Therefore, update the driver to explicitly control this bit during
powergate transitions.
